Gujarat is preparing to launch its new Industrial Policy 2026 on June 15. This policy is designed to accelerate industrial growth within the state, attract new investments, and foster a climate of innovation. A key objective is to enhance the ease of doing business, with specific provisions to support advanced manufacturing sectors and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s).
In parallel, the Northeast India Infrastructure Summit & Exhibition 2026 (NEIINFRA 2026) is scheduled to take place in Shillong, Meghalaya, from June 15 to June 16, 2026. This summit aims to stimulate investment and forge partnerships crucial for the development of infrastructure across the Northeast region of India. The event will serve as a platform for stakeholders to discuss and collaborate on infrastructure projects.
